LAREDO, Texas â The Laredo Bucks will be Out & About in the community this week.
HELP A FALLEN SOLDIER
· The Bucks will have a memorial game in honor of Juan Rodriguez this Saturday when they host the Corpus Christi Rayz. The Bucks will sell red, white and blue bracelets for $2 with all profits from the sale of the bracelets being donated to the Juan Rodrigo Rodriguez fund. Southern Sanitation will donate $250 for every Bucks goal during the game. People can donate to the Juan Rodrigo Rodriguez fund, account number #51803452, at any LNB location in Laredo.
